We are booked, 1st class, on the 8:13 AM train from Paris Est to Luxemburgh.  How far in advance should we arrive at the station?

Best answer by thibcabe

10-15 min in advance is usually a good idea for big stations like Paris-Est. More is not necessary since platforms are announced last-minute resulting in everyone rushing at the same time...

Thank you but a follow up question.  Is there time that should be allowed for security checks, luggage screening, etc.?  Also….we are Canadian….is there passport control that also adds time?

There is no security check,  luggage screening or passport control within the Schengen/EU area.

Only if  you would travel to/from UK there are checks.
